Living In Center Point, AL

Center Point, Alabama is a town with just under 17,000 residents. Families with young children should fit right in, as kids under 5 make up an above-average percentage of the population. At an average age of just over 34, the city's population skews notably younger than most cities in Alabama. In terms of housing, residents are fairly evenly split between owning (51%) and renting (49%) their home. At $847/month, the average rent is roughly equal to the state average.

Center Point residents have an average commute of about 29 minutes. Driving a car or truck is the most common means of commuting to work, chosen by 39% of commuters, while public transportation isn't used extensively. A small percentage of workers commute on foot.

There are three primary industries in Center Point: healthcare, retail, and manufacturing. Together, these industries make up 19% of the workforce in the city. Meanwhile, in terms of job function, many of the city's residents work in sales, as 7% of the city's population reports this as their field of work, the highest number of any field. Center Point workers take home an average annual income of just under $51K, less than their peers elsewhere in the state. Center Point's average income also falls below the national average ($73,345). Among residents older than 25 in Center Point, 7% possess a Bachelor's degree and 2% have earned a Master's degree or Doctorate.

What is the average rent in Center Point?

The average rent of a studio apartment in Center Point is $450 per month. For a one-bedroom apartment it's $535 per month. For a two-bedroom apartment the average rent is $725 per month.
